The Role of Minimally Invasive Spine Surgery in Adults

Many of these patients have osteoporotic spinal fractures or lumbar degenerative disease, which may result in stenosis, neurogenic claudication, or radiculopathy. While some of these patients may be in good health, others may not be good candidates for general anesthesia, or they may be taking certain medications that make general anesthesia a risk.

This approach avoids cutting through major muscle groups, which can lead to reduced pain and shorter hospital stay. Minimally invasive spine surgery is now common for many adults. In adults, minimally invasive spine surgery can be used in patients with degenerative disc disease.

Among the advantages of minimally invasive spine surgery is a faster recovery time, less pain, and less blood loss than traditional open spine surgery. Additionally, these procedures are ideal for older patients, because they require less hospitalization and recovery time. In addition to the reduced pain and reduced postoperative recovery time, minimally invasive surgery is also available for patients with advanced age.
